    Will Tinnitus Ever Get Better?

    Dont forget your perception of Tinnitus is also related to your external sound enviroment. Sometimes its easy to think that the T has got louder. When in fact the external sounds are so quiet, there is nothing to mitigate the internal sound. Hope this helps. Peace & Love. Chimp.
